Abstract

The invention discloses a kind of composite cooling motor rear end plate, including the disk body for being provided with inner chamber interlayer;Disk body middle part is provided with bearing hole, and left end outer wall section extends radially outwardly to form flange;Disk body includes left side wall, the right side wall of inner chamber interlayer both sides;Disk body outer wall is provided with water supply connector, water out adapter;Water supply connector, water out adapter are respectively fixedly connected with disk body outer wall, and its endoporus is connected with disk body inner chamber interlayer respectively, form cooling water channel;Some muscle posts are provided with the interlayer of disk body inner chamber between left side wall, right side wall;Muscle post is connected with left side wall, right side wall;Further improvement is that:Disk body is provided with some through holes;Through hole sequentially passes through left side wall, muscle post, right side wall from left to right, constitutes cooling air channel, and through hole is not connected with disk body inner chamber interlayer;Through hole is distributed on disk body bearing hole surrounding.Structural strength of the present invention is high, and deformation is small, to bearing good cooling results when using.

Description

Composite cooling motor rear end plate
Technical field
The present invention relates to technical field of motors, and in particular to a kind of motor rear end plate.
Background technology
Bearing is installed, operationally rear end cap middle (center) bearing produces certain heat to motor, and substantial amounts of heat is produced in housing, and these heats can raise rear end cap middle (center) bearing temperature, and the normal of influence bearing is used in motor rear end plate.Therefore, the motor rear end plate of prior art takes certain cooling provision, as motor rear end plate is provided with inner chamber interlayer, form cooling water channel, cooled down with to rear end cap middle (center) bearing, the motor rear end plate of this structure can play certain cooling effect to rear end cap middle (center) bearing, but find there is certain defect in use:The motor rear end plate for being provided with inner chamber interlayer is easily deformed, and the normal of influence motor is used.
The content of the invention
In view of the shortcomings of the prior art, proposition is a kind of to substantially reduce rear end cap deformation in use to the present invention, to ensure the composite cooling motor rear end plate that motor is normally used.
The present invention is achieved through the following technical solutions technical goal.
Composite cooling motor rear end plate, including it is provided with the disk body of inner chamber interlayer;The disk body middle part is provided with bearing hole, and left end outer wall section extends radially outwardly to form flange;The disk body includes left side wall, the right side wall of inner chamber interlayer both sides;The disk body outer wall is provided with water supply connector, water out adapter;The water supply connector, water out adapter are respectively fixedly connected with disk body outer wall, and its endoporus is connected with disk body inner chamber interlayer respectively, form cooling water channel;It is theed improvement is that:Some muscle posts are provided with the interlayer of the disk body inner chamber between left side wall, right side wall;The muscle post is connected with left side wall, right side wall.
In said structure, the disk body is provided with some through holes;The through hole sequentially passes through left side wall, muscle post, right side wall from left to right, constitutes cooling air channel, and through hole is not connected with disk body inner chamber interlayer.
In said structure, the through hole is distributed on disk body bearing hole surrounding.
The present invention compared with prior art, has the positive effect that:
1st, some muscle posts are provided with the interlayer of disk body inner chamber between left side wall, right side wall, structural strength of the present invention is significantly improved, present invention deformation in use are substantially reduced, to ensure that motor is normally used.
2nd, disk body is provided with some through holes, through hole sequentially passes through left side wall, muscle post, right side wall from left to right, constitute cooling air channel, so, compound cooling structure is formed together with cooling water channel, cooling capacity of the invention is significantly improved so that the present invention is when in use, rear end cap middle (center) bearing can be sufficiently cooled, it is ensured that rear end cap middle (center) bearing is normally used.
3rd, through hole is distributed on disk body bearing hole surrounding, and the present invention can be made equably to cool down when in use.

Specific embodiment
The invention will be further described below according to accompanying drawing and in conjunction with the embodiments.
Composite cooling motor rear end plate shown in the drawings, including it is provided with the disk body 1 of inner chamber interlayer;The middle part of disk body 1 is provided with bearing hole, and left end outer wall section extends radially outwardly to form flange 1.1;Disk body 1 includes left side wall 1.2, the right side wall 1.3 of inner chamber interlayer both sides;The outer wall of disk body 1 is provided with water supply connector 2, water out adapter 5;Water supply connector 2, water out adapter 5 are respectively fixedly connected with the outer wall of disk body 1, and its endoporus is connected with the inner chamber interlayer of disk body 1 respectively, form cooling water channel;Some muscle posts 4 are provided between left side wall 1.2, right side wall 1.3 in the inner chamber interlayer of disk body 1;Muscle post 4 is connected with left side wall 1.2, right side wall 1.3.
Disk body 1 is provided with some through holes 6 for being distributed on bearing hole surrounding(In the present embodiment, 8 through holes 6 for being distributed on bearing hole surrounding are provided with);Through hole 6 sequentially passes through left side wall 1.2, muscle post 4, right side wall 1.3 from left to right, constitutes cooling air channel, and through hole 6 is not connected with the inner chamber interlayer of disk body 1.
